3/9/2024 0 Comments 3d paint for windows 10![]() ![]() ![]() Microsoft is taking over the NVIDIA Optimus (MSHybrid) control from NVIDIA. Paint 3D just runs on Dedicated Graphics anyway. Set NVIDIA Control Panel to prefer Integrated Graphics. ![]() It just runs in the background without being asked. Just Reboot and hope that Paint 3D will be closed/killed.The following things do not help to fix this issue. Set a profile for Paint 3D in Windows Graphics Settings to force Paint 3D to run on Integrated Graphics.Disallow Paint 3D in Windows Background Settings from working in the background.With those workarounds, the dGPU will go back to 'OFF' in Windows Idle. Apparently Microsoft thinks that system power consumption does not matter as long as you're plugged into the wall socket. The dGPU activity stops once you unplug the charger. You might ask: "Who ever uses Paint 3D?" - well, I did. This apparently only happens after the first time you open and close Paint 3D on a fresh Windows install. Paint 3D causes the dGPU to stay 'ON' by running in the Background forever, even after Reboot. Based on some user feedback and my own testing around XMG FUSION 15, I reported a new bug to Intel (Case 00534640), hoping they will forward this to Microsoft and get it fixed. ![]()
